New team members should understand how request tracing flows across our microservices before touching any environment. Each environment (dev, staging, prod) runs its own trace collector, and span sampling rates differ deliberately: dev samples everything, prod samples one percent. Trace context propagates via headers injected by the gateway, so never strip inbound headers in middleware. Misconfigured propagation is the top cause of broken traces. To verify your environment, compare against the reference configuration below.

deployment values, kajep-kageg:
[praix]
host = praix.paliqcorp.corp
user = praix_svc
database = praix_prod

Capacity note for on-call — the Pixelgrotto thumbnail cache leaks again. Evictions stop firing once the handle map exceeds its soft cap, so RSS creeps roughly 2% per hour under steady load until the box tips over around day three. Long-term fix is in the Marloft rewrite; until then we're papering over it with tighter caps and a scheduled compaction. If a node's already wedged, just recycle it. The stopgap constants we're running with are these.

constants for tafog-kahag:
RATE_LIMITS = {
    "sorir": 697,
    "oliox": 683,
    "holax": 176,
    "casox": 60,
    "pelius": 382,
}

Handover: Exportron retry queue

Hi Mira — handing over the failed-export retries. Exports that hit a timeout land in the retry queue and get three attempts with backoff; after that they're parked and need a manual requeue from the admin panel. Watch for customers reporting duplicates — that usually means a double requeue. The current retry settings are as follows.

settings of bajog-fawig:
oliael:
  log_level: warn
  metrics_host: metrics.oliael.zemvarsys.internal
  pin: 0267
  pool_size: 32

## Who to ping about GiftNote

Welcome aboard! GiftNote is our donation-receipt mailer for the Larchfield Fund. Template tweaks go to the comms folks; delivery failures and bounce weirdness go to the platform crew. Don't push template changes on Fridays — receipts batch over the weekend. For anything GiftNote-related, start with the address below.

billing contact of kaweg-tajeg = drudor.lamion.oliath@torvalabs.test